The Arcs Live at The Fillmore — December 16


“Viva la Dan, Dan’s the Man!”

Back in 2007 I fell in love with music again because of Dan Auerbach. His band, The Black Keys, made rock and roll relevant to a new generation of listeners and music appreciators.

Two years later in November 2009, I saw Auerbach play at The TLA as Dan Auerbach and the Fast Five. At the time I didn’t know that the drummer of that outfit was none other than Patrick Hallahan, the drummer from My Morning Jacket. It’s a testament to the many musical friends Auerbach has in as many places.

Auerbach is at it again — last night he launched into a tidal wave of tunes with his new solo project, The Arcs, to a sold-out crowd at The Fillmore in Fishtown.

Auerbach wears many hats: he is a producer, a singer, a songwriter and a ripping guitarist. He works with a wide range of artists, including New Orleans legends like Dr. John and Brooklyn-based rapper  Mos Def (now known as Yasiin Bay). Auerbach’s pushed the  musical envelope by taking risks and melding genres. He always said that The Black Keys’ sound was supposed to be a mix of the guitar licks from one of his idols, blues musician Junior Kimbrough, and the backbeats created by his favorite hip-hop group, The Wu-Tang Clan.

The Arcs is comprised of two drummers sharing one ride cymbal, a keyboard player, a bassist, three mariachi influenced backup singers and Auerbach himself. The sold out crowd chanted “Viva la Dan, Dan is the man!” as he led his band and the crowd through songs from Yours, Dreamily and an EP titled The Arcs vs. The Inventors, which features Dr. John and Los Lobos’ David Hidalgo.

Auerbach is a master of creative marketing, songwriting and stage prowess. The Arcs closed out the night with an encore that included their single, “Stay in My Corner” — a ballad with heavy hitting boxing references that was released on May 2, 2015, which was the night of the Pacquiao/Mayweather fight.
